Sweet Savings: Budget-Friendly Wedding Cake and Dessert Ideas for Your Oklahoma Wedding

Your wedding day is a sweet celebration of love, and what better way to indulge in the joy of the occasion than with delectable desserts? If you're planning an Oklahoma wedding on a budget, you don't have to sacrifice the sweetness of the day. In this blog post, we'll explore budget-friendly wedding cake and dessert options that will have your taste buds dancing without breaking the bank.

1. Cupcake Towers:

Opt for a cupcake tower instead of a traditional tiered wedding cake. Cupcakes are not only adorable but also more affordable. You can have a variety of flavors and decorate them to match your wedding theme.

2. Mini Dessert Buffet:

Create a mini dessert buffet featuring an assortment of bite-sized treats such as mini pies, brownie bites, and cookies. It's a cost-effective way to offer a variety of sweets that cater to different tastes.

3. Donut Wall:

Donuts are a crowd-pleaser, and a donut wall can be both fun and budget-friendly. Decorate a wall with hooks or pegs to hang donuts, and let your guests help themselves to these delightful treats.

4. Ice Cream Sundae Bar:

Cool off with an ice cream sundae bar. Offer a selection of ice cream flavors and a range of toppings. It's a unique and interactive dessert option that won't melt your budget.

5. Fruit Displays:

Oklahoma's abundance of fresh fruits can be a budget-friendly dessert option. Create colorful fruit displays with a variety of seasonal fruits. You can also include yogurt or chocolate dip for added sweetness.

6. Sheet Cakes:

Rather than an elaborate wedding cake, consider having a small, beautifully decorated wedding cake for cutting and sheet cakes in the kitchen for serving to your guests. Sheet cakes are a more economical way to feed a large group.

7. DIY Desserts:

If you have a passion for baking, consider baking some of the desserts yourself or enlisting the help of family and friends. It's a personal and budget-friendly option that adds a sentimental touch to your day.

8. Cookies and Milk:

Serve freshly baked cookies with glasses of cold milk. This nostalgic and comforting dessert option is sure to delight your guests.

9. Groom's Cake:

A groom's cake is a tradition in some parts of Oklahoma and can be a budget-friendly way to provide an additional cake. It can reflect the groom's interests, making it unique and special.

10. Local Bakeries and Home Bakers:

Support local bakeries and home bakers who may offer more budget-friendly options than larger, specialized cake shops. Explore their menu and find the perfect dessert for your celebration.

11. Fake Cake with Real Top Tier:

Consider having a fake cake with a real top tier. The fake layers can be decorated to look like a grand cake, while the top tier is real and ready for cutting and saving.

12. Pies:

Oklahoma is known for its delicious pies. You can have a variety of pie flavors, from classic apple to pecan, that won't break the bank.

13. Cultural Desserts:

Incorporate your cultural heritage by including traditional desserts that have sentimental value. This can be a meaningful and budget-friendly addition to your dessert table.

Your Oklahoma wedding dessert options don't have to be a budget-busting expense. With these creative and cost-effective ideas, you can satisfy your sweet tooth and delight your guests without compromising your wedding budget. It's all about savoring the moment and celebrating your love in a way that's both delightful and economically sensible. Sweet savings and sweet moments await! 🍰❤️✨
